Description Richard W.M. Jones 2018-11-18 11:37:05 UTC
Description of problem:

qemu in Rawhide fails when I test injecting EIO errors into requests
using nbdkit:

nbdkit: memory[1]: debug: error: pread count=1024 offset=102400 flags=0x0
nbdkit: memory[1]: error: injecting EIO error into pread
nbdkit: memory[1]: debug: sending error reply: Input/output error
qemu-system-x86_64: /builddir/build/BUILD/qemu-3.1.0-rc1/hw/scsi/scsi-bus.c:1374: scsi_req_complete: Assertion `req->status == -1' failed.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):

qemu 2:3.1.0-0.1.rc1.fc30

How reproducible:

Unknown.

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Unknown, I'll try to come up with a reproducer if I can make one work locally.

Comment 2 Richard W.M. Jones 2018-11-18 11:53:50 UTC
Actually yes this is easily reproducible with qemu from git.

(1) nbdkit -f -v --filter=error memory size=64M error-rate=100%

(2) x86_64-softmmu/qemu-system-x86_64 -device virtio-scsi,id=scsi -drive file=nbd:localhost:10809,format=raw,id=hd0,if=none -device scsi-hd,drive=hd0

qemu-system-x86_64: hw/scsi/scsi-bus.c:1374: scsi_req_complete: Assertion `req->status == -1' failed.
Aborted (core dumped)

Comment 3 Richard W.M. Jones 2018-11-18 15:11:57 UTC
40dce4ee61c68395f6d463fae792f61b7c003bce is the first bad commit
commit 40dce4ee61c68395f6d463fae792f61b7c003bce
Author: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ini>
Date:   Sat Oct 13 11:52:34 2018 +0200

    scsi-disk: fix rerror/werror=ignore
    
    rerror=ignore was returning true from scsi_handle_rw_error but the callers were not
    calling scsi_req_complete when rerror=ignore returns true (this is the correct thing
    to do when true is returned after executing a passthrough command).  Fix this by
    calling it in scsi_handle_rw_error.
    
    Signed-off-by: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ini>

Comment 6 Richard W.M. Jones 2019-03-07 07:52:31 UTC
This was fixed in 3.1.0-rc3.  Since 3.1.0 (final) was released a few
months ago and is present in Fedora 30 and Rawhide I'm going to close this
bug now.
